We added a new feature to the roll-up field in Softr Databases, and I will show you how it works.

Before, we had a roll-up field in our databases which would help you filter the data, but we added a conditional filter to it. This help filter the data even further.

You will need to go to the roll-up field type settings and add the conditions here. For instance, if you had the campaign budget as $10,000, as it is shown in my case, you can filter and show the budget of the campaigns that are only completed.

You need to choose the status of that campaign and then add the value as completed. And here you go, you have a filtered data.

It is showing the campaign budget that are already completed. I hope this new functionality helps you better manage your data directly within Softr.
